What is a Hand Grip Strengthener?

A hand grip strengthener, also known as handgrips or grippers, are small exercise tools that you squeeze to build up hand and forearm strength.

Basic grippers have two handles you squeeze together, with resistance coming from the flexible metal the handles are attached to. This metal is spiraled into a loop at the top of the grippers. Other more advanced grippers actually look like a weird pair of pliers or a vice grip and have adjustable resistance.

Benefits of Hand Grippers

One thing working with hand grips will do is strengthen and tone your forearms. The flexors and extensors found in your forearm will be what is affected the most.

These muscles control your fingers and in turn control the opening and closing of your hand. Using a grip strengthener will help you gain strength in your hand by strengthening these muscles.

By strengthening your hand and forearm muscles, you are also increasing your hand endurance, which will, in turn, maximize what you get out of grip exercises — anything from opening jars to pull-ups.

This also comes in handy when you are carrying heavy objects like full suitcases or toolboxes. After continuous use of the strengthener, you will notice that your hands and arms won’t get as tired as quickly.

Another perk is that hand grippers actually up the overall strength of your hand. This is what will help you when it comes to building up other muscles. More hand strength means holding on to weights longer.

This perk also applies to sports — it helps tennis players as well as gymnasts, rock climbers, and athletes that need to be able to support your weight with your hands.

Even musicians can benefit from working with hand grip strengtheners. These tools help you build more than just hand and wrist strength, but also enhance your dexterity.

It can actually help build up your independent finger movement to help optimize pressure on your instrument. This same concept can also go for those that type a lot.

Hand Grip Strengthener Buyer’s Guide

At first thought, buying a hand grip strengthener would seem pretty simple. However, there are actually many different types of hand strengtheners — which can be confusing and overwhelming.

There are even whole kits or bundles that offer finger, hand, and forearm strengthening and stretching.

Which strength are you wanting to work on?

You have supporting grip strength which kicks in when you hold something for long periods of time. Then you have pinch grip strength and crush grip strength.

You now need to decide which strength you are wanting to focus on, or if you want to work on all of them.

There is also the difference between general hand strength and finger strength.

Finger strengtheners will help increase your pinch strength and dexterity in your fingers. These strengtheners come with buttons for each finger to press rather than just squeezing with your whole hand.

Actual hand strengtheners focus on the hand and forearm muscles.

What is your needed resistance level?

Now you need to decide if you want less resistance or more resistance. If your grip is weaker than you think it should be or you are just wanting to train your grip for enhanced endurance, a lighter resistance will work.

It may be easier to squeeze but it will require you to do more reps, which helps with the endurance.

For those with grips that are already pretty strong but are wanting to take up the power you have, then heavier resistance is what you should be looking for.

Keep an eye out to make sure the gripper you are looking at isn’t too intense. The higher-end and most expensive ones tend to be best suited for professional athletes.

Varying Resistance Levels

If you find that you need to work on every type of hand and finger strength, then you will need more than just one resistance level. Basic hand grippers come at a set resistance level which means you would have to purchase multiple grippers, each with a different resistance level.

The other option is to find an adjustable hand grip strengthener. These allow you to train with different resistances by purchasing one gripper as opposed to two or more. These are also good even if you are just working on one type of strength. You can adjust them as needed as your strength increases.

Remember to Keep Safety in Mind

When it comes to grip strengtheners, grippers made of steel are the safest. Steel is much less likely to break when you use it.

A breaking grip strengthener means parts are more than likely flying in all directions.

Another thing when it comes to safety is that you will want to be able to get a good grip on it. Grippers that come with rubberized handles are best at not slipping out of your hand as you work.
